Nén bộ nhớ trong Windows 10 là gì?

Mục lục:

Nén bộ nhớ trong Windows 10 là gì?
Nén bộ nhớ trong Windows 10 là gì?

Video: Nén bộ nhớ trong Windows 10 là gì?

Video: Nén bộ nhớ trong Windows 10 là gì?
Video: Cài đặt thông báo và thanh trạng thái trên android 12 - YouTube 2024, Tháng mười một
Anonim
Windows 10 sử dụng tính năng nén bộ nhớ để lưu trữ nhiều dữ liệu hơn trong bộ nhớ của hệ thống của bạn so với cách khác. Nếu bạn truy cập Trình quản lý tác vụ và xem chi tiết sử dụng bộ nhớ của mình, bạn có thể thấy rằng một số bộ nhớ của bạn bị "nén". Đây là những gì có nghĩa là.
Windows 10 sử dụng tính năng nén bộ nhớ để lưu trữ nhiều dữ liệu hơn trong bộ nhớ của hệ thống của bạn so với cách khác. Nếu bạn truy cập Trình quản lý tác vụ và xem chi tiết sử dụng bộ nhớ của mình, bạn có thể thấy rằng một số bộ nhớ của bạn bị "nén". Đây là những gì có nghĩa là.

Nén bộ nhớ là gì?

Tính năng nén bộ nhớ là một tính năng mới trong Windows 10 và không khả dụng trên Windows 7 và 8. Tuy nhiên, cả Linux và Apple đều sử dụng tính năng nén bộ nhớ.

Theo truyền thống, nếu bạn có 8 GB RAM và ứng dụng có 9 GB nội dung để lưu trữ trong RAM đó, ít nhất 1 GB sẽ phải "được phân trang" và được lưu trữ trong tệp trang trên đĩa máy tính của bạn. Việc truy cập dữ liệu trong tệp trang rất chậm so với RAM.

Với bộ nhớ nén, một số trong đó 9 GB dữ liệu có thể được nén (giống như một tập tin Zip hoặc dữ liệu nén khác có thể được thu nhỏ) và giữ trong RAM. Ví dụ, bạn có thể có 6 GB dữ liệu không nén và 3 GB dữ liệu nén thực sự chiếm 1,5 GB trong RAM. Bạn sẽ lưu trữ tất cả 9 GB dữ liệu gốc trong bộ nhớ RAM 8 GB của mình vì nó sẽ chỉ chiếm 7,5 GB khi một số dữ liệu đã được nén.

Có nhược điểm nào không? Vâng, vâng và không. Nén và giải nén dữ liệu mất một số tài nguyên CPU, đó là lý do tại sao không phải tất cả dữ liệu được lưu trữ nén - nó chỉ được nén khi Windows cho rằng cần thiết và hữu ích. Nén và giải nén dữ liệu với chi phí của một số thời gian CPU là nhiều, nhanh hơn nhiều so với phân trang dữ liệu ra đĩa và đọc nó từ tệp trang, tuy nhiên, vì vậy thường đáng để cân bằng.

Bộ nhớ bị nén là xấu?

Nén dữ liệu trong bộ nhớ là tốt hơn nhiều so với thay thế, đó là phân trang dữ liệu ra đĩa. Nó nhanh hơn việc sử dụng tệp trang. Không có nhược điểm nào đối với bộ nhớ nén. Windows sẽ tự động nén dữ liệu trong bộ nhớ khi cần dung lượng và bạn không cần phải suy nghĩ về tính năng này.

Nhưng bộ nhớ nén không sử dụng một số tài nguyên CPU. Hệ thống của bạn có thể không hoạt động nhanh như nó không cần phải nén dữ liệu trong bộ nhớ ngay từ đầu. Nếu bạn thấy nhiều bộ nhớ nén và nghi ngờ đó là lý do khiến PC của bạn hơi chậm, giải pháp duy nhất cho việc này là cài đặt thêm bộ nhớ vật lý (RAM) trong hệ thống của bạn. Nếu PC của bạn không có đủ bộ nhớ vật lý cho các ứng dụng bạn sử dụng, việc nén bộ nhớ tốt hơn tệp trang - nhưng bộ nhớ vật lý nhiều hơn là giải pháp tốt nhất.

Làm thế nào để xem chi tiết bộ nhớ nén trên PC của bạn

Để xem thông tin về lượng bộ nhớ được nén trên hệ thống của bạn, bạn sẽ cần sử dụng Trình quản lý tác vụ. Để mở nó, hãy nhấp chuột phải vào thanh tác vụ của bạn và chọn "Task Manager", nhấn Ctrl + Shift + Esc hoặc nhấn Ctrl + Alt + Delete và sau đó nhấp vào "Task Manager"

Nếu bạn thấy giao diện Task Manager đơn giản, hãy nhấp vào tùy chọn "Chi tiết khác" ở cuối cửa sổ.
Nếu bạn thấy giao diện Task Manager đơn giản, hãy nhấp vào tùy chọn "Chi tiết khác" ở cuối cửa sổ.
Nhấp vào tab "Hiệu suất" và chọn "Bộ nhớ". Bạn sẽ thấy dung lượng bộ nhớ được nén trong “Đang sử dụng (Đã nén)”. Ví dụ, trong ảnh chụp màn hình bên dưới, Trình quản lý Tác vụ cho thấy rằng hệ thống của chúng tôi hiện đang sử dụng 5.6 GB bộ nhớ vật lý của nó. 425 MB trong đó 5,6 GB là bộ nhớ nén.
Nhấp vào tab "Hiệu suất" và chọn "Bộ nhớ". Bạn sẽ thấy dung lượng bộ nhớ được nén trong “Đang sử dụng (Đã nén)”. Ví dụ, trong ảnh chụp màn hình bên dưới, Trình quản lý Tác vụ cho thấy rằng hệ thống của chúng tôi hiện đang sử dụng 5.6 GB bộ nhớ vật lý của nó. 425 MB trong đó 5,6 GB là bộ nhớ nén.

Bạn sẽ thấy số này dao động theo thời gian khi bạn mở và đóng ứng dụng. Nó cũng sẽ chỉ dao động khi hệ thống hoạt động ở chế độ nền, vì vậy hệ thống sẽ thay đổi khi bạn nhìn chằm chằm vào cửa sổ tại đây.

Nếu bạn di chuột qua phần ngoài cùng bên trái của thanh bên dưới Bố cục bộ nhớ, bạn sẽ thấy thêm chi tiết về bộ nhớ đã nén của mình. Trong ảnh chụp màn hình dưới đây, chúng tôi thấy rằng hệ thống của chúng tôi đang sử dụng 5.7 GB bộ nhớ vật lý của nó. 440 MB của bộ nhớ này là bộ nhớ nén và bộ nhớ nén này lưu trữ khoảng 1,5 GB dữ liệu mà nếu không sẽ được lưu trữ không nén. Điều này dẫn đến tiết kiệm bộ nhớ 1,1 GB. Nếu không có bộ nhớ nén, hệ thống của chúng tôi sẽ có 6,8 GB bộ nhớ trong sử dụng chứ không phải là 5,7 GB.
Nếu bạn di chuột qua phần ngoài cùng bên trái của thanh bên dưới Bố cục bộ nhớ, bạn sẽ thấy thêm chi tiết về bộ nhớ đã nén của mình. Trong ảnh chụp màn hình dưới đây, chúng tôi thấy rằng hệ thống của chúng tôi đang sử dụng 5.7 GB bộ nhớ vật lý của nó. 440 MB của bộ nhớ này là bộ nhớ nén và bộ nhớ nén này lưu trữ khoảng 1,5 GB dữ liệu mà nếu không sẽ được lưu trữ không nén. Điều này dẫn đến tiết kiệm bộ nhớ 1,1 GB. Nếu không có bộ nhớ nén, hệ thống của chúng tôi sẽ có 6,8 GB bộ nhớ trong sử dụng chứ không phải là 5,7 GB.
Image
Image

Điều này có làm cho quá trình hệ thống sử dụng nhiều bộ nhớ không?

Trong bản phát hành ban đầu của Windows 10, “kho nén” được lưu trữ trong tiến trình Hệ thống và là “lý do mà quá trình Hệ thống dường như tiêu thụ nhiều bộ nhớ hơn các phiên bản trước”, theo một bài đăng trên blog của Microsoft.

Tuy nhiên, tại một số thời điểm, Microsoft đã thay đổi cách hoạt động của nó. Bộ nhớ nén không còn được hiển thị như một phần của quá trình Hệ thống trong Trình quản lý Tác vụ (có thể do nó rất khó hiểu đối với người dùng). Thay vào đó, nó hiển thị trong phần Chi tiết bộ nhớ trên tab Hiệu suất.

Trên Bản cập nhật dành cho người sáng tạo của Windows 10, chúng tôi có thể xác nhận rằng bộ nhớ nén chỉ được hiển thị trong Chi tiết bộ nhớ và quá trình Hệ thống vẫn ở mức 0,1 MB sử dụng trên hệ thống của chúng tôi ngay cả khi hệ thống có nhiều bộ nhớ nén. Điều này tiết kiệm sự nhầm lẫn, vì mọi người sẽ không tự hỏi tại sao quá trình Hệ thống của họ bí ẩn sử dụng quá nhiều bộ nhớ.

Đề xuất: